Space Saving
A traditional wood-burning stove with a flat front can take up a lot of wall and floor area that can restrict the placement of furniture in rooms. A corner log burner offers the warmth and cosiness of a fireplace, but without taking up space.
This kind of stove is ideal for smaller spaces such as townhouses, apartments and small wood burning stove apartments. It is also ideal for open plan kitchen and dining areas, where it can create a soothing mood in the evening as you prepare food, play board games or just sit back with your loved ones and family.
In addition the corner woodburner is the best option for modern self-build and extension projects. Modern wood stoves are designed to be energy efficient and comply with Eco Design 2022 legislation, which means they consume less fuel for the same amount of heat, which makes them a great choice for modern home living.
Installing a corner woodburning fireplace into an extension or new home will save space and use corners that aren't being used. There are numerous designs to choose from, regardless of whether you want an open or closed combustion model. The latest designs of log stoves include clearer and larger windows that can be seen from all angles of the room. This is especially impressive when placed in the corner of the room.
When you install a woodburning stove, you will need to consider where you can keep firewood, kindling and the log basket. This can be achieved by choosing a corner woodburner that comes with an integrated compartment.
A woodburning corner stove that is glazed is a great choice for an modern kitchen or dining room, as it can be utilized to create an instant focal point, and make the room feel warm and welcoming when entertaining guests. It is also possible to use a corner stove in your bedroom to create a romantic, cosy environment when you're sitting at home or contemplating. The soft glow of the flames will help you to relax and unwind and the sounds of the flames will create an idyllic backdrop for your sleep.

Energy Efficiency
You can look for a variety of energy-efficient options in the wood stove. These include combustion efficiency and overall efficiency, which is the amount of heat that is delivered to the room. The EPA maintains a database with information on the efficiency rating of each model. There is also the rating for heating capacity which tells you how much hot air the stove can generate.
The type of fuel can also affect the effectiveness of a stove's efficiency. If you are buying an electric stove that burns wood it is possible to select one that burns pellets or logs instead of traditional briquettes. Pellets and logs are much more efficient than briquettes and they don't produce more particulate emissions. Some stoves have log compartments that are able to store longer logs.
By reducing the demand on the electricity grid in the country, a fireplace that burns wood can reduce your home's carbon footprint. If everyone replaced their solid fuel stoves by modern Ecodesign compliant models and the reduction in particulate emissions would be comparable to removing around 1.7 million cars from the road.
A corner wood stove is also more energy efficient than earlier models that require more fuel to produce the same amount of heat. The less fuel you use results in less energy consumption and less pollution of the air.
Some modern wood burning stoves feature a false flue system that eliminates the requirement for a chimney. This makes installation simpler in a room that lacks space for a conventional chimney. But, it's still essential to ensure that the flue is properly installed and that you have regular chimney inspections.
